DRCHSD Fall Communication Series I: Creating A Successful Community Outreach and Education Program Aligned with Your CHNA

Session Description: Increasing volumes and countering outmigration requires a strategic approach that melds the essential components of your strategic plan, community health needs assessment and communication plan.  Learn how to draw out the key data from these strategic documents and achieve critical KPI’s for your Critical Access Hospital.

Speaker: Amy Yaeger, VP of Strategic Services, Legato Healthcare

Date & Time: Thursday, October 27 from 11:00 – 12:00 pm CST

Learning Objectives:

•    Three components to increase volumes and counter outmigration•    Tactics for melding the three components together•    Communication strategies to stakeholders•    Evaluation is in the numbers
